| S | |
| Term | Meaning |
| Sai | Three-pronged metal weapon |
| Sagi | Heron |
| Sakotsu | Collarbone |
| Sakotsu shuto | Collarbone knife-hand |
| Sammai | Concentration; Absorption |
| San | Three. See also numerals |
| Sanchin | Three battle; Tension |
| Sanchin dachi | Three Battle stance |
| San-ju | Thirty |
| Sankaku | Triangle |
| Sankyo | Immobilization No. 3 |
| Sasae | Block |
| Sasae tsurikomi ashi | Lifting pulling foot block |
| Satori | Enlightenment |
| Seigyo | Control |
| Seiho | Spirit (healing) division or method |
| Seiken | Forefist / twisting fist |
| Seishin | Soul; Spirit of God |
| Seiza | Correct sitting; Formal sitting position |
| Sempai | Senior |
| Sensei | Teacher |
| Senshin | Concentration; Undivided attention; Singleness of purpose |
| Seoi | Shoulder |
| Sesshin | Concentrating; Unifying the mind |
| Shi | Four. See also numerals |
| Shiai | Contest |
| Shichi | Seven. See also numerals |
| Shiden | Historical tradition |
| Shihan | Master. Instructor (4th-5th Dan) |
| Shiho | Four corners, or all directions |
| Shiho Giri | Four directional cut |
| Shiho nage | All (four) directions throw |
| Shika | Historian |
| Shiken | Test; Examination |
| Shikyo uchi | Finger spear |
| Shimbun | Newspaper |
| Shime | Choke / Strangle |
| Shime waza | Choking techniques |
| Shinai | Bamboo Sword |
| Shinjitsu | Reality |
| Shinken | Real sword; Real fist; Earnest |
| Shinko | Faith; Faith that looks up; Stretch |
| Shinsei | Divine nature; Holiness; Godliness |
| Shinwa | Friendship; Fellowship |
| Shinyo | Faith; Faith effort, in your own work |
| Shizen | Natural |
| Shizen-tai | Natural posture |
| Sho | One. See also numerals |
| Shodai | First generation; Founder |
| Shodai Soke | Founding Father; First Soke |
| Shogei | All Arts |
| Shomei | Summons of destiny; Call of God |
| Sho men uchi | Knife hand strike to front of head |
| Shorei | Encouragement |
| Shotei | Palm heel strike (also may use as block) |
| Shotokan | A Karate System Founded by Gichin Funikoshi. See also Funikoshi, Gichin |
| Shu | To Learn |
| Shudo | Leadership; Guidance |
| Shugyo | Austere practice; Hard training |
| Shuho | Taking Principle |
| Shuto | Swordhand; Chop |
| Shuto uchi | Knife hand strike |
| Shuto uke | Knife hand block |
| So | Head; Master; Phase |
| Sode | Sleeve |
| Sode tsuri komi goshi | Sleeve lifting pulling hip throw |
| Soke | Head Master; Grand Master; Head of the Family |
| Soke Sho | The Head Master Writes |
| Sokuji | The Diet Cure |
| Sokuto | Foot sword |
| Soto | Outer; Outside |
| Soto maki komi | Outer winding throw |
| Soto maki komi harai | Outside wrapping pulling sweep |
| Soto mikazuigeri | Outer crescent kick |
| Soto shuto | Outside knife-hand |
| Soto ude uke | Outside forearm block |
| Suki | Gap; Ungaurded moment; Dead time |
| Sukui | Scooping |
| Sukui nage | Scooping throw |
| Sumi gaeshi | Corner throw / reversal |
| Sumi otoshi | Corner drop |
| Sun Dome | To stop one inch |
| Sute | Sacrifice |
| Sutemi | Sacrifice or roll |
| Sutemi waza | Sacrifice techniques |
| Suwari Waza | Sitting techniques |
